Answering the call

One of the biggest problems with on-call is that alerts are poorly reported due to the lack of a competent alerting system. If the alert is reported, it fails to go to the correct engineer who could actually answer the call. The alert gets passed from one department to another. So when it finally reaches the correct on-call individual, it’s nowhere near as riveting.

The answer to this problem is to implement a messaging system that competently picks up alerts and makes sure problems are adequately handled from the get-go. The advantages of uses an app

A mobile app eliminates the necessity of a physical pager for alerts. It’s a much cleaner approach that is not only more convenient but also more efficient because planning and scheduling are improved. A mobile app presents the opportunity to respond promptly and correctly assign issues to the most qualified engineer.

Compensatory hours

Being an on-call engineer can be really annoying if there is no financial compensation for the extra working hours. It is very important that an engineer who has been answering on-call alerts for several hours receives time off from work. This not only benefits their physical health but also their mental condition. It can be quite stressful to lose sleep and then still be expected to show up for work. A proper program that rewards on-call agents with time off helps maintain a balance. It’s important to remember that employees and co-workers are just as valuable and important as customers.
